Mortgage Fraud

Mortgage Fraud is one of the most devastating types of criminal activity in our society today. The process of mortgage fraud, in and of itself becomes more and more sophisticated everyday.  Mortgage fraud has developed into a highly complex tangle of lies throughout the home buying-and-selling process. It has a long-range, devastating effect on society and the housing market at large. A few examples of mortgage fraud are:

     *  Appraisal Fraud
     *  Employment/income fraud
     *  Failure to disclose liabilities
     *  Mortgage fraud ring
     *  Mortgage servicing fraud
     *  Occupancy fraud
     *  Predatory mortgage lending

 Predatory mortgage lending is sometimes more detailed in structure and extremely more difficult to recognize.  U.S. consumers are often victims of this type of mortgage fraud.  While legally conducting business, a few of these brokers and lenders are finding loopholes in the system to obtain an accelerated profit from their transactions.
  These types of mortgage fraud transactions include:

     *  Balloon loans: after a series of low payments, the remaining balance is due in a lump sum
     *  Convincing borrowers to refinance a loan several times, each time increasing monthly payments or amounts owed
     *  Encouraging applicants to include false information
     *  Encouraging borrowers to leave signature lines blank
     *  Failure to include a Good Faith Estimate, Truth in Lending and/or Settlement Statement
     *  Failure to explain unexpected costs at the settlement
     *  Presenting loan amounts higher than the value of the home
